  4. An ECDSA Nullifier Scheme and a Proof of Identity Application

    ZK-SNARKs (Zero Knowledge Succinct Noninteractive ARguments of Knowledge) are one of the most promising new applied cryptography tools: proofs allow anyone to prove a property about some data, without revealing that data.
